UPS Systems deliver scalable 3-phase power protection.

Press Release Summary:



Rated from 10-40 kVA in 400/230 V, Smart-UPS® VT series offers centralized uninterruptible power protection for small data centers and other applications with dense power requirements. Up to 4 units of any capacity and redundancy can be connected in parallel and remotely managed, monitored, and controlled via Web/SNMP interface. Solutions use cool-running 3-stage inverter technology and features scalable runtime and modular design that allow for as-needed expansion.

APC Offers Redundancy and Increased Capacity with Parallel Smart-UPS® VT Units



Compact Three-Phase Power Protection with Scalable Runtime for Small Data Centers and Other Business Critical Applications

WEST KINGSTON, R.I. - January 28, 2008 - APC, a global leader in integrated critical power and cooling services, today announced the availability of parallel capability for its Smart-UPS VT three-phase power protection line. Providing customers with greater flexibility for capacity growth and redundancy, this new functionality makes the Smart-UPS VT ideal for small data centers, large retail stores, regional offices, wiring closets, and applications with dense power requirements. Customers can now easily expand their power protection system by connecting up to four Smart-UPS VT units in a parallel configuration in any combination of capacity and redundancy.

The Smart-UPS VT family, currently available in 10-40kVA in 400/230V, offers centralized uninterruptible power protection with the Legendary Reliability® of APC's award-winning Smart-UPS family. Its patented cool running three stage inverter technology delivers high efficiency even when operating at less than 30% load, which is typical for UPS running in parallel. The system's scalable runtime and modular design allows for easy expansion as necessary.

Best-in-class efficiency and a reduction in rating of electrical infrastructure (wires, transformers, and generators) combine to make the Smart-UPS VT the most cost-effective three-phase power protection available. Dual-mains input, automatic and maintenance bypasses, intelligent battery management and input power factor correction ensure that power remains uninterrupted while keeping installation costs low.

Also, service time is greatly reduced through the use of hot-swappable batteries. Customers can manage, monitor, and control the UPSs from anywhere on their network through a simple, intuitive Web/SNMP interface.

About APC-MGE

In February 2007, APC and MGE UPS Systems combined to form a $3.5 billion (2.4 billion) Critical Power & Cooling Services business unit of Schneider Electric. Together, APC and MGE offer the industry's most comprehensive product and solution range for critical IT and process applications in industrial, enterprise, small and medium business and home environments. APC and MGE solutions include uninterruptible power supplies (UPS), precision cooling units, racks, and design and management software, including APC's InfraStruXure® architecture the industry's most comprehensive integrated power, cooling, and management solution. Backed by the industry's broadest service organization and an industry leading R&D investment, the combined company's 12,000 employees help customers confront today's unprecedented power, cooling and management challenges. Schneider Electric, with 112,000 employees and operations in 190 countries, had 2007 annual sales of $25 billion (17.3 billion). For more information on APC and MGE, please visit www.apc-mge.com.
